Career journey and achievements
Dr. Bitan Ghosh began his professional career as a Civil Engineer with Daelim Industrial Company Limited in Kuwait, where he worked from July 2014 to September 2015. During this period, he contributed to a Greenfield EPC project at the Mina Al-Ahmadi Refinery, working in coordination with PMC Foster Wheeler and client KNPC.
From June 2016 to September 2017, he served as Executive Director at Senbo Engineering Limited, Kolkata. His responsibilities included strategic direction, operational planning, infrastructure project execution, and international business expansion. His work included involvement in infrastructure assignments such as Kolkata Metro works and the Northeast Frontier Railway tunnel project in Nagaland.
From February 2017 to December 2020, Dr. Bitan Ghosh served as Chief Executive Officer and Director of Orphius Technologies Private Limited, a technology venture focused on IoT, cybersecurity, digital infrastructure, and technologyled solutions.
Since August 2021, he has served as Founder and Director of Naexo Consulting (OPC) Private Limited, a consulting platform focused on infrastructure advisory, engineering design, project management, and strategic consulting.
Since October 2015, Dr. Bitan Ghosh has been associated with Ghosh Group as Director, with responsibilities spanning enterprise strategy, capital allocation, business structuring, and cross-sector coordination across infrastructure, consulting, technology, and real estate verticals. His role involved supporting the Group’s strategic expansion, institutional development, and operational alignment across multiple business entities. His work has also included involvement in nationally significant infrastructure programs, including engagements alongside global consultants such as AECOM and Padeco on the Dhubri Phulbari Bridge Project for NHIDCL. In April 2025, he was appointed Managing Director of the Group, taking on wider leadership responsibilities for strategic growth, governance, investment direction, and organizational development.

Elevent Index
Elevent Index is a structured framework created to assess startup investment quality, funding preparedness, and capital readiness. The framework is based on the principle that startup evaluation should consider both internal business quality and the practical readiness of a business to raise and effectively utilize external capital.
Investment Quality Score
The Investment Quality Score (IQS) evaluates startups through eleven distinct parameters. Each parameter is scored from 0 to 10, and the final score is calculated through stage-based weighted allocation.
IQS = Σ (Ei × Wi)
Where Ei represents the assigned score for each Elevent parameter and Wi represents the stage-based weightage. Since total weightage equals 100%, IQS remains on a scale of 0–10.
| Code | Dimension | Description |
|---|---|---|
| E1 | Founder and Leadership Strength | Founder capability, execution ability, adaptability, ethics, leadership depth, and vision. |
| E2 | Market Opportunity Assessment | Market size, timing, accessibility, demand validation, and future potential. |
| E3 | Product and Innovation Strength | Innovation quality, product relevance, differentiation, scalability, and defensibility. |
| E4 | Business Model Viability | Revenue model, pricing structure, profitability, unit economics, and scalability. |
| E5 | Financial Strength | Financial controls, reporting quality, runway, capital efficiency, and discipline. |
| E6 | Competitive Positioning | Market positioning, defensibility, differentiation, customer loyalty, and competitive advantage. |
| E7 | Customer and Growth Indicators | Customer retention, acquisition quality, traction, growth metrics, and expansion potential. |
| E8 | Governance and Compliance | Compliance discipline, transparency, governance standards, documentation, and legal structure. |
| E9 | Operational Readiness | Systems, scalability, processes, talent structure, and operational efficiency. |
| E10 | Investment and Exit Potential | Investor attractiveness, valuation logic, return potential, and exit pathways. |
| E11 | Future Sustainability Index | ESG readiness, resilience, long-term adaptability, and technological relevance. |

Capital Readiness Score
The Capital Readiness Score (CRS) integrates both Investment Quality Score (IQS) and Funding Readiness Score (FRS) into a unified capital readiness metric. Both scores are measured on a 10-point scale, while CRS uses a weighted 70:30 methodology that prioritizes business quality while incorporating funding preparedness.
| CRS = 7 × IQS + 3 × FRS
Since both IQS and FRS are calculated out of 10, CRS automatically produces a score on a scale of 0 to 100 without additional normalization. Example: If IQS = 8.0 and FRS = 7.0, CRS = (7 × 8.0) + (3 × 7.0) = 77/100 |
Capital Readiness Matrix
The Capital Readiness Matrix maps IQS and FRS to determine whether a startup is highly investable, structurally weak, promising but underprepared, or fully investment-ready. Within this framework, IQS reflects business quality while FRS measures fundraising preparedness.
